People are still grieving

Most estates take at least a year to probate. Some take much longer. But even with simple estates, that first year without your loved one can be hard to endure. Coupled with the jobs of executor or personal representative, it can be too much to juggle.

You must answer to the heirs

If you are probating the estate alone, you are responsible for giving periodic updates and other information to the decedent’s heirs. Some of those may be your own relatives, and the relationships may be wrought by whatever baggage got dragged in from childhood. It can be a very uncomfortable position to be in.

You lack the time

Along with having a keen eye for detail, estate probaters must have the time to devote to the task. That can be hard to carve out for parents already struggling to juggle parenting with working. This new task list could wind up being the straw that breaks the camel’s back.
